Karel Michal

Karel Michal was a Czech writer known for his satirical and imaginative works. He gained recognition for his unique style and often explored themes of absurdity and the human condition in his writings.

  1. 1. Bubáci Pro Všední Den

    Povídky

    Set in a world where the supernatural intertwines with the mundane, this collection of short stories explores the eerie and often humorous encounters of ordinary people with ghosts and mythical creatures. Each tale delves into the absurdity and unpredictability of life, as characters navigate through bizarre situations that challenge their understanding of reality. With a blend of dark humor and philosophical musings, the stories offer a satirical reflection on human nature and societal norms, leaving readers both entertained and contemplative.
